Professional Background
Jasmine Elizabeth, MS, is an influential voice and thought leader in her community, recognized for her dynamic work as the host of the popular podcast, "Jas Jewels." With a robust background in organizational development and a commitment to empowering individuals, Jasmine serves as the founder and consultant of J. Elizah's Consulting LLC. This firm specializes in branding and administrative support tailored for small businesses and entrepreneurs, reflecting Jasmine's dedication to fostering growth and innovation. Her consulting approach stems from a rich tapestry of personal experiences and professional achievements, aimed at uplifting communities, especially focusing on women and youth initiatives.
Jasmine's journey has been punctuated by notable contributions to her local Denver, Colorado community, where she tirelessly advocates for those in need. One shining example is her successful event, "Thanksgiving in July," which provided over 600 homeless individuals with a full-service barbecue and free haircuts—showcasing her commitment to community welfare and inclusive support.
She is the author of the deeply personal memoir "Return to the Knew," self-published in 2017. This work chronicles her journey towards self-confidence and esteem, resonating with many who seek to reclaim their narrative and embrace their authentic selves. Education and Achievements
Jasmine's educational background lays a solid foundation for her consulting work. She holds a Master of Science degree in Nonprofit Management & Philanthropy from Bay Path University, which has honed her strategic insight into managing and leading charitable organizations effectively. Additionally, she earned a Bachelor's degree in Sociology from American International College. Her rigorous studies at the University of Denver's Sturm College of Law further enhanced her understanding of legal frameworks pertinent to nonprofit and community-focused endeavors.
Beyond her impressive academic credentials, Jasmine is recognized as the 2017 Rising Star Graduate of the Urban Leadership Foundation Leadership, a testament to her influential role in leadership development and community engagement. Notable Achievements
In addition to her speaking engagements and community-centric events, Jasmine's previous roles illustrate her extensive expertise in the nonprofit sector and community leadership. She has held significant positions such as:
- Director of Program Operations at COLORADO URBAN LEADERSHIP FOUNDATION, where she directed initiatives aimed at nurturing emerging leaders within urban settings.
- Creative Partner at J. Elizah's Consulting, collaborating with various organizations to elevate their impact through strategic planning and creative solutions.
- Vision Manager at The Equity Project, LLC, where she played a pivotal role in bringing forth equitable practices in community development.
- Assistant Director of Program and Partnerships at uAspire, focusing on educational access and support for students seeking higher education.
Her prior experience also highlights her dedication to youth empowerment through her initiative, "Beauties to Behold," a leadership development program tailored for young girls aspiring to cultivate their leadership skills and self-esteem. Through this program, Jasmine has positioned herself as a transformative figure in fostering the next generation of female leaders.
Jasmine's involvement in the community extends to organizing wide-reaching events like The Family Field Day and the "Fathers Of Our Community" initiative. Her creativity and drive continue to inspire others, bringing together diverse groups to build understanding, collaboration, and growth.
